Man arrested and charged with multiple offences linked to downtown Chilliwack shooting

Feb 9, 2024 | 2:50 PM

CHILLIWACK — Mounties in Chilliwack say a 33-year-old man has been arrested and charged with several offences for his alleged role in a shooting in downtown Chilliwack last Sunday morning, February 4.

According to a news release from Corporal Carmen Kiener, spokesperson for the Chilliwack RCMP, police say Ryan Diablo, 33, was located in Chilliwack and arrested without incident on Wednesday, Feb. 7 in connection with a shooting in the 9300 block of Nowell Street.

Diablo has been charged with the following offences:

  • Discharge firearm with intent
  • Aggravated assault
  • Failure to comply with court order

Police say the suspect and the victim in this incident were known to each other, but there is no indication they have any ties to the Lower Mainland gang conflict.
